Mitchells & Butlers PLC is looking for a Part Time Food Runner at Harvester in Croxley Green, England. You will support the bar and waiting teams to serve food and drinks while ensuring everything is stocked, clean, and tidy.
This role provides flexible shifts, a massive 33% discount across all brands, and other benefits such as earned wage access and 28 days paid holiday. No prior experience is necessary, just a willingness to learn!

How to prepare for a job interview at Mitchells & Butlers PLC
β¨Know the Role Inside Out
Before your interview, make sure you understand what a Food Runner does.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ities like supporting the bar and waiting teams, and keeping everything stocked and tidy. This shows you're genuinely interested in the role.
β¨Show Your Willingness to Learn
Since no prior experience is necessary, highlight your eagerness to learn and adapt. Share examples from your past where you've quickly picked up new skills or tackled challenges. This will resonate well with the hiring team.
β¨Emphasise Teamwork
As a Food Runner, you'll be part of a team. Be ready to discuss how you work well with others. Think of times when you've collaborated effectively, whether in school, previous jobs, or even group projects.
